About The Position

Amazon’s WW Operations & Robotics, OIS Security team is accountable for network security selections to ensure availability, speed to market, and control cost. They build systems that detect, assess, and mitigate security risk across the global infrastructure and are accountable for keeping the Amazon Infrastructure secure. This role involves providing technical thought leadership in the development of next-generation networks, with a focus on information security and network reliability. The Network Security Engineer will ensure that the fulfillment and transportation infrastructure is securely designed and implemented with high standards to maintain customer trust. This position offers a challenging and rewarding opportunity to examine networks, systems, and services from a security perspective, solve security challenges, participate in the design, build, deployment, and operation of security-focused infrastructure, and provide consultation, architectural review, and risk assessment of Amazon’s systems and networks. The role also includes operating the security posture of the largest fulfillment network in the world and providing guidance and mentoring to network support teams to develop their skills and reinforce security best practices. Driving root cause resolution of network events most impactful to the business is also a key responsibility.

Responsibilities

  • Own Network Security choices for solutions including robotics, automation, and embedded devices.
  • Drive security into tools used by Amazonians every day through solid interpretation of authentication protocols, core network and system security principles along with up-to-date understanding of modern attack patterns and methods.
  • Assist in implementing and maintaining security measures to safeguard systems and infrastructure.
  • Perform Network security design reviews and risk assessments.
  • Develop and maintain security risk register and partner with risk owners to ensure security risks are remediated.
  • Simplify ACLs required to clear the Network backlog for new and existing solutions.
  • Collect, Evaluate, and Summarize data from a variety of sources to create compelling written and verbal communications.
